[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-commits
Subject:    [kaccounts-providers] /: Prepare owncloudWizard to hold ownCloud information
From:       Alex Fiestas <afiestas () kde ! org>
Date:       2015-10-15 21:01:18
Message-ID: E1ZmpeI-0000yK-Me () scm ! kde ! org
[Download RAW message or body]

Git commit bf2ffee28155b99101c1bf2a5eea309e7efbc461 by Alex Fiestas.
Committed on 17/04/2012 at 15:17.
Pushed by mklapetek into branch 'master'.

Prepare owncloudWizard to hold ownCloud information

M  +30   -0    owncloud.cpp
M  +15   -0    owncloud.h

http://commits.kde.org/kaccounts-providers/bf2ffee28155b99101c1bf2a5eea309e7efbc461

diff --git a/owncloud.cpp b/owncloud.cpp
index 6a4dcd7..19841d0 100644
--- a/owncloud.cpp
+++ b/owncloud.cpp
@@ -43,3 +43,33 @@ OwnCloudWizard::~OwnCloudWizard()
 {
 
 }
+
+void OwnCloudWizard::setUsername(const QString& username)
+{
+    m_username = username;
+}
+
+void OwnCloudWizard::setPassword(const QString& password)
+{
+    m_password = password;
+}
+
+void OwnCloudWizard::setServer(const KUrl& server)
+{
+    m_server = server;
+}
+
+const QString OwnCloudWizard::username() const
+{
+    return m_username;
+}
+
+const QString OwnCloudWizard::password() const
+{
+    return m_password;
+}
+
+const KUrl OwnCloudWizard::server() const
+{
+    return m_server;
+}
\ No newline at end of file
diff --git a/owncloud.h b/owncloud.h
index 0e89ec7..984a6f6 100644
--- a/owncloud.h
+++ b/owncloud.h
@@ -21,12 +21,27 @@
 
 #include <QtGui/QWizard>
 
+#include <kurl.h>
+
 class OwnCloudWizard : public QWizard
 {
     Q_OBJECT
     public:
         explicit OwnCloudWizard(QWidget* parent = 0, Qt::WindowFlags flags = 0);
         virtual ~OwnCloudWizard();
+
+        void setUsername(const QString &username);
+        void setPassword(const QString &password);
+        void setServer(const KUrl &server);
+
+        const QString username() const;
+        const QString password() const;
+        const KUrl server() const;
+
+    private:
+        QString m_username;
+        QString m_password;
+        KUrl m_server;
 };
 
 #endif //OWNCLOUD_H
\ No newline at end of file

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ic